Germans Attack American Wires Amid Toul Battlefield Actions

American machine gunners repelled a low flying German air attack near Leidheprey northwest of Toul. German artillery targeted telephone and telegraph lines while signal corps restored communications under heavy shelling. Ambulance crews risked No Man's Land to tend the wounded as Salvation Army workers withdrew from exposed positions.

German Thrust Viewed By War Department Strategists

Washington reports the U S war department expects another powerful German thrust at Allied lines. The review notes no final battle and cites General Foch as allied commander in chief. It mentions Americans captured and escaping, plus persistent fighting from Avre to Noyon and in Flanders with mixed gains and sustained Allied coordination.

Half of Liberty Loan Subscribed, Reports Say

Washington reports show half of the three billion dollar third Liberty Loan remains unsubscribed with more days of campaigning ahead. Subscriptions exceed 1.6 billion across regions and states. Seattle and Tacoma lead in Washington. Oregon touts statewide quota completion. St Louis Fed district totals 374,000 subscribers.

Big Shipment to Belgium and Northern France Delayed

Washington reports a ten day pause in food shipments to allied civilians to divert three million bushels of grain to Belgium. Part of the wheat will aid residents in German occupied northern France. Cables from the Belgian relief commission urged this shift to prevent bread shortages across the region.

Sedition bill advances to final action in Congress

Washington reports the sedition bill consents to twenty years in prison and ten thousand dollars in fines for disloyal acts or utterances aimed at obstructing the army draft or Liberty bonds, with conferees endorsing broad Senate provisions. Plan Strike for Seattle to Protest Persecution

Washington April 22 A Seattle labor leadership move calls for a general strike May 1 to protest alleged persecution of Thomas Money and others convicted for a bomb plot. Senator Poindexter denounces and calls for severe action, while labor leaders split over the strike. In Chicago the fifth jury selection week begins for 113 I W W members charged under the espionage act. government lawyers question defense-tendered jurors as they aim to swear in a jury this week.

Quake Hits Hemet and San Jacinto with Damaged Towns

San Jacinto and Hemet, California, were struck by an aftershock at 7:00 am and 9:14 am, causing loose bricks and wreckage in the business districts. One life lost is Frask Darnell, drowned off Santa Monica after the pier collapse. Reports mention office buildings tilting in Los Angeles and widespread fear as tremors disrupted daily activity.

Germans Claim Capture of 183 Americans and 23 Guns

Berlin reports from headquarters claim Germans captured 183 American prisoners and 23 machine guns. The report also says German storm troops advanced about two kilometers into American lines at Leicheprey with heavy American losses. Separate dispatches describe intense fighting west of the Renners forest near Toul where Americans and French repelled German waves, counterattacking to retake Seicheprey. The front remains volatile with artillery duels, gas shells, and renewed efforts near Lys and Ypres.
